What Is a Commercial HVAC Service Contract and How Does It Work?

A commercial HVAC service contract serves as a formal agreement between your business and an experienced HVAC provider centered on proactive care rather than fixing issues after they occur. The agreement commits to regular professional attention for commercial HVAC systems, detecting early signs of trouble before they escalate into expensive disasters.

In demanding commercial facilities including corporate buildings, shops, dining establishments, and industrial sites, this preventive approach keeps indoor environments comfortable and daily workflow continuous.

Contracts typically detail the planned maintenance schedule, exact work to be completed, priority handling timelines, and any additional benefits such as reduced rates or performance reports. Most agreements typically include 2–4 professional visits per year, timed around seasonal changes to ready cooling equipment for summer and prepare heating for winter.

During each visit, licensed professionals conduct thorough examinations of key system elements, from compressors and condensers to thermostats and ductwork, ensuring optimal function.

Key Components of a Standard Commercial HVAC Maintenance Agreement

Most reliable commercial HVAC maintenance agreement features detailed system evaluations that measure operating efficiency and spot beginning stages of component fatigue.

Technicians check refrigerant levels, evaluate electrical systems, inspect drive components and bearings, and analyze complete operational effectiveness to stop problems before they occur.

Routine Inspections and Cleaning

Routine inspections combined with deep cleaning of evaporator and condenser coils, air filters, and condensate drains maintain clean airflow and avoid performance degradation.

This step is critical for maintaining airflow and preventing strain on the system.

Priority Emergency Response

Fast-track emergency service guarantees quicker response times when unexpected problems occur, minimizing downtime for your facility during critical periods.

Discounted Repairs and Parts

Special pricing on service and replacement parts provide substantial savings whenever repairs outside scheduled visits are required.

These elements function collectively to prevent downtime and contain spending.

Differences between basic and premium plans allow businesses to pick the level that fits their operations. Entry-level agreements provide core preventive care at an economical rate, concentrating on primary checks and maintenance.

Higher-tier contracts extend protection substantially, adding parts and labor coverage, broader emergency provisions, comprehensive reporting, and additional scheduled visits for higher-value or more complex commercial systems.

Understanding common exclusions remains important for practical planning. Typical contracts do not cover issues caused by improper use, lack of maintenance, intentional damage, or external events, so reviewing these clauses carefully protects both parties and avoids confusion.

How Much Does a Commercial HVAC Service Contract Cost?

Being aware of the expense model of a commercial HVAC service contract enables organizations to plan finances accurately and recognize true value. In Southern California, annual pricing typically ranges from $1,500 to $8,000 or more per system, based on variables including system capacity, sophistication, quantity of equipment, and protection level.

Basic preventive plans focus primarily on inspections and cleaning at the more affordable range, while thorough all-inclusive contracts that include parts, labor, and extensive emergency support typically cost more.

Several variables influence final pricing. Larger business properties with several rooftop systems or advanced chiller installations demand additional service hours and materials, raising the agreement price.

Geographic location within the region can also play a role, with increased need in urban centers like central Los Angeles occasionally leading to modestly higher pricing related to technician travel time and appointment density.

Pricing Tiers and What They Include

Multiple coverage options allow businesses to pick the level that fits their unique situation and expense limitations.

Basic Preventive Plans

Basic preventive plans provide core preventive care at economical costs, concentrating on primary checks and maintenance.

Full-Service with Parts and Labor

Comprehensive agreements provide broad security including parts replacement, labor coverage, and broader emergency support.

Comparing scheduled maintenance expenses to one-off service calls obviously shows significant savings over time.

One-time service requests frequently cost between $300 and $600, and after-hours/emergency pricing often doubling or tripling that amount. Several unplanned service calls within twelve months can easily exceed several thousand dollars.

Contracts provide stability through evenly spread expenses while avoiding cost increases.

Commercial HVAC Service Contracts in Southern California: Local Considerations

The unique climate in the Southern California region demands specialized attention for commercial HVAC systems. Intense summer heat creates considerable pressure on air conditioning equipment and rooftop systems, accelerating wear and increasing the likelihood of failures during peak demand periods.

Coastal areas introduce additional challenges from humidity that can promote mold growth in ventilation systems and ductwork if not properly managed.

Precise area placement across the region significantly influences maintenance requirements and effectiveness.

Facilities adjacent to major roadways experience higher levels of dust and airborne pollutants that require more frequent and thorough cleaning to sustain maximum effectiveness.

Priority response capabilities become particularly valuable during extreme heat periods when system failures can quickly impact business operations and customer comfort.
